WebDec 12, 2024 · The 2024 Black Student Success Week is scheduled for April 24 through April 28. This year’s theme is “ Vision to Action: Building Systems and Structures for Black Student Success.” The focus of the week-long event will be on successful approaches to ensuring Black and African American students succeed at California community colleges.
